Lung Recruitment Maneuver for Predicting Fluid Responsiveness in Children

Lung recruitment maneuver induces a decrease in stroke volume, which is more pronounced in hypovolemic patients. The authors hypothesized that the changes of dynamic variables through lung recruitment maneuver could predict preload responsiveness in pediatric patients with lung protective ventilation

Treatment and study plan

lung recruitment maneuver

Diagnostic Test

Lung recruitment maneuver (application of continuous positive airway pressure of 25 cm H2O for 20 s)

Primary outcomes

  1. photoplethysmographic waveform

    Time frame: change from baseline photoplethysmographic waveform after lung recruitment maneuver within 30 seconds
